Basudev Tripathy is a scholar working on Ecology, Nature and Landscape Conservation and Global and Planetary Change. According to data from OpenAlex, Basudev Tripathy has authored 53 papers receiving a total of 172 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 31 papers in Ecology, 15 papers in Nature and Landscape Conservation and 14 papers in Global and Planetary Change. Recurrent topics in Basudev Tripathy’s work include Aquatic Invertebrate Ecology and Behavior (14 papers), Mollusks and Parasites Studies (12 papers) and Turtle Biology and Conservation (9 papers). Basudev Tripathy is often cited by papers focused on Aquatic Invertebrate Ecology and Behavior (14 papers), Mollusks and Parasites Studies (12 papers) and Turtle Biology and Conservation (9 papers). Basudev Tripathy collaborates with scholars based in India, United States and Japan. Basudev Tripathy's co-authors include Kailash Chandra, K. Sivakumar, B. C. Choudhury, Satyaranjan Behera, K. A. Subramanian, Jonathan D. Ablett, J. M. Julka, Lalit Kumar Sharma, Mukesh Thakur and Barna Páll‐Gergely and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Scientific Reports and Marine Pollution Bulletin.
